Output c3fc4c6113ef20d1d7ea655164a31c45af277a5332c4cebbd8cb264c0cf11bdc:16

value
5000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 18d5ad2920e21e32f323a36cebcf0e11ff98f962 OP_EQUAL
address
33xL7eMWiKfL2sD2RAo8SLwFrbhxuyMzyS
transaction
c3fc4c6113ef20d1d7ea655164a31c45af277a5332c4cebbd8cb264c0cf11bdc
spent
true